Abstract :
Single-layer h-BN films may be grown on Ni(111) by using B-trichloroborazine (ClBNH)3. Scanning tunneling microscopy shows perfect monolayers with a very low density of defects. This way of producing stoichiometric, ultimately thin h-BN layers is an alternate route to the use of borazine (HBNH)3. The h -BN growth patterns indicate a reaction mechanism that proceeds via six-membered ring opening of these cyclic BN molecules. A set of density functional calculations for B-trichloroborazine, borazine, and Ntrichloroborazine yields bond energies and bond lengths for these molecules.
